As the automotive sector accelerates into a tech-driven future, Artificial Intelligence is at the heart of innovation that extends far beyond manufacturing and driving assistance. One major area gaining traction is Vehicle-to-Everything (V2X) communication, where AI enables vehicles to exchange data with traffic lights, infrastructure, pedestrians, and other vehicles. This interconnected ecosystem, powered by AI, allows for real-time decision-making, helping prevent collisions, ease congestion, and improve traffic flow. For instance, Ford and Audi are actively testing V2X systems in smart cities to reduce wait times at red lights and notify drivers of upcoming hazards. Additionally, AI is revolutionizing energy efficiency in electric vehicles (EVs). Algorithms are now being trained to optimize battery usage, manage charging schedules, and calculate the most energy-efficient routes based on terrain, traffic, and driving behavior. This integration not only extends vehicle range but also aligns with global goals for sustainability and carbon neutrality.
Beyond the vehicle itself, AI is transforming how automotive companies interact with customers throughout the entire lifecycle of ownership. Post-purchase services, including predictive maintenance alerts, remote diagnostics, and AI-powered scheduling, are becoming the new standard. Automakers like Hyundai and Toyota are introducing AI-based digital twins โ virtual replicas of cars โ to track wear and tear, usage data, and performance in real time. This level of insight allows for personalized service plans, early detection of problems, and an enhanced sense of safety for the user. AI is also helping manufacturers improve marketing and sales strategies through behavioral analytics, helping brands predict customer needs and offer hyper-personalized experiences via online platforms or dealerships. ๐ญ 1. Smart Manufacturing with AI
How it works:
AI-powered robots and predictive analytics streamline vehicle production lines.
Example:
BMWโs โFactory of the Futureโ uses AI to optimize logistics and assembly.
Tip:
Integrate AI with IoT devices for real-time monitoring of manufacturing processes.
๐ง 2. Predictive Maintenance
What it means:
AI systems detect potential faults before they cause breakdowns.
Example:
Tesla uses AI to predict when a battery or brake component might fail.
Tip:
Use AI to analyze telematics and create automated maintenance alerts for fleet vehicles.
๐ 3. Autonomous Driving
Core Tech:
AI uses machine learning, computer vision, and sensor fusion to enable self-driving.
Example:
Waymo (by Google) and Teslaโs Full Self-Driving (FSD) feature rely heavily on AI.
Tip:
Stay updated on government policies and safety protocols for AVs (Autonomous Vehicles).

๐ 4. AI in Vehicle Design & Testing
Impact:
AI simulates crash tests, wind tunnel data, and driver ergonomics faster and more affordably.
Example:
Porsche uses AI-driven simulation to test design changes virtually.
Tip:
Invest in AI tools that reduce physical prototype needs โ they save time and resources.

๐ฅ 5. Enhanced Customer Experience
Use Cases:
AI chatbots, voice assistants, and personalized dashboards in infotainment systems.
Example:
Mercedes-Benzโs MBUX uses AI to learn driver preferences and voice commands.
Tip:
Incorporate AI-driven personalization to boost customer loyalty and post-sales service.
๐ 6. AI in Supply Chain & Logistics
Benefits:
Better route planning, demand forecasting, and inventory optimization.
Example:
Volkswagen uses AI to predict demand spikes and reduce delivery times.
Tip:
Use AI analytics to detect bottlenecks and automate warehousing systems.
